Public bug reported: I have seen something similar to this with possible work-arounds but nothing will fix it for me at the present.
The cursor frequently becomes invisible and I can only track it by pressing the 'Ctrl' key, so I can keep working but with difficulty. Previously, when I took a screen-shot the invisible cursor would become visible in the screen-shot, but this does not now seem to be the case. Also, previously, suspending the system and then bringing it out of the suspended state would restore the visibility of the cursor, but now the system will not even suspend and has to be completely rebooted to recover. My current system is ArtistX 0.9, upgraded to Ubuntu 10.04, and it has worked reliably for a long time. I can't remember when the problem with the invisible cursor began but it was some months back, not recent, and well after the upgrade.
